Content Determination of Oxytocin Injection by HPLC Gradient Elution Method
OBJECTIVE To establish an HPLC method for determination of content of oxytocin injection.METHODS An Welch Xtimate® C18(150 mm×4.6 mm,3 μm)column was used with the detection wavelength of 220 nm,and the flow rate of 1.0 mL·min-1,the column temperature was set at 40 ℃.The content determination of oxytocin injection was performed using acetonitrile-water-phosphate solution(0.2 mol·L-1 anhydrous dihydrogen phosphate solution,adjusted the pH value to 6.2 with sodium hydroxide solution,15∶70∶15)as mobile phase A,acetonitrile-water-phosphate solution(0.2 mol·L-1 anhydrous dihydrogen phosphate solution,adjusted the pH value to 6.2 with sodium hydroxide solution,70∶15∶15)as mobile phase B.Gradient elution was used.RESULTS Blank solvent and blank excipient solution did not interfere with the determination of oxytocin.The linear ranges of the content of oxytocin injection was 2.007 8-20.077 8 IU·mL-1(r=0.999 9),the average recovery was 98.54%(RSD of 1.34%).The quantification limit and detection limit were 8.393 0 ng·mL-1and 2.517 9 ng·mL-1.The test solution was stable at room temperature within 24 h.CONCLUSION The method is accurate,simple,reliable,and can be used for the determination of the content in oxytocin injection.
